When Brian and Barbara are sitting at her table, Barbara's cigarette has an inconsistent length.

When Barbara tries to tear away Sheba to return to the vet's office with her, the front passenger-side door of Sheba's automobile is opened/closed from shot to shot.

When Barbara visits Sheba for the first time, she's carrying a bouquet.

She sits in the living room and puts her left arm over the flowers.

In the next shot, her arm is under.

When Sheba is rampaging through Barbara's house in search of her journal, you can see a crew member in the mirror behind her as she goes to sit.

The LP that Steven picks up in Sheba's workshop is "Kaleidoscope" by Siouxsie and the Banshees (1980).

The band's song that plays over the scene, however, is "Dizzy," which was first released as a single in 1992.

When Sheba goes up to her daughter's bedroom, she is listening to music on headphones, which disappear too quickly between shots.

When Sheba confronts Barbara about her diary, the makeup (eyeliner) she has smudged by crying changes.

One moment she had dark thick eyeliner on, the next moment she has very little of eyeliner still on, and then the eyeliner comes back as before.

Steven is stated as being fifteen years old and in Year 10.

Pupils become fifteen during Year 10 (except in exceptional circumstances).

Later in the film, Sheba states that he is going to be sixteen in May, i.

he was already fifteen before entering Year 10.

In Notes on a Scandal, Judi Dench plays Barbara Covett, a spinster history teacher at a British public school, who narrates the story with tart, dolorous wit. A self-described "battle-axe", she is so ensconced by her own loneliness, so embittered by her inability to achieve intimacy with another human, that she has turned inwardly toxic.
